The football helmet market is significantly propelled by an escalating focus on player safety and injury prevention. Heightened awareness regarding concussions and other head trauma in sports, particularly football, has led to increased demand for helmets equipped with advanced protective technologies. Governing bodies and sports organizations are implementing stricter safety standards and protocols, compelling manufacturers to innovate and players/teams to adopt newer, safer equipment, thereby fostering market expansion. This regulatory push, combined with a cultural shift towards prioritizing athlete well-being, forms a robust foundation for market growth.
Furthermore, continuous advancements in material science and manufacturing processes contribute substantially to market acceleration. The development of lighter, more durable, and more effective impact-absorbing materials allows for the creation of helmets that offer superior protection without compromising comfort or performance. Increased participation in football, both at professional and amateur levels globally, particularly in emerging markets, also drives the demand for helmets. This expanding user base, coupled with the cyclical replacement of equipment due to wear and tear or new safety mandates, ensures a consistent and growing market for football helmets.

The football helmet market faces significant restraints, primarily due to the high cost associated with advanced helmet technologies. Innovations in materials, smart features, and customization processes translate into higher manufacturing expenses, which are then passed on to consumers. This elevated price point can be a deterrent, especially for amateur leagues, youth sports organizations, and individual players with budget constraints, limiting market penetration and adoption of the safest available equipment. The perceived economic barrier can thus slow the overall market growth despite strong safety mandates.
Another major restraint is the ongoing concern and litigation surrounding concussions and long-term neurological injuries, which can lead to negative public perception of the sport itself. While helmets are designed to mitigate impact, they cannot eliminate all risks, and continuous legal challenges or media scrutiny can affect participation rates and, consequently, demand for equipment. Furthermore, market saturation in developed regions, coupled with product longevity for basic models, means that growth often relies on replacement cycles driven by either new technology or mandatory upgrades, rather than new market entrants, posing a continuous challenge for sustained expansion.

The football helmet market faces several complex challenges, with maintaining product innovation while managing increasing production costs being a primary concern. The continuous demand for enhanced safety features, advanced materials, and integrated smart technologies requires substantial investment in research and development, which can escalate manufacturing expenses. Balancing the need for cutting-edge protection with affordability is a critical dilemma, as excessively high prices can alienate a significant portion of the market, particularly at the amateur and youth levels, thereby hindering broader adoption of the safest helmets.
Another significant challenge stems from the intense competitive landscape, where established players and new entrants continuously vie for market share through product differentiation and aggressive marketing. This competition can lead to pricing pressures and reduced profit margins. Furthermore, supply chain disruptions, particularly those affecting specialized materials or electronic components for smart helmets, can impact production schedules and product availability. Addressing consumer perception, particularly the lingering public concerns about the inherent risks of football despite helmet advancements, also remains a continuous challenge that influences participation rates and ultimately, market demand.
